What Are Dropdown Options?
Dropdown options are a form of binary options where traders choose from a list of predefined outcomes. These outcomes are typically related to the price movement of an asset, such as whether the price will rise or fall within a specific time frame. The dropdown menu simplifies the decision-making process, making it easier for beginners to understand and execute trades.

Examples of Dropdown Options Trades
Here are a few examples to illustrate how dropdown options work:
- **Example 1**: You predict that the price of gold will rise in the next 5 minutes. You select "Up" from the dropdown menu and invest $10. If the price of gold increases within the time frame, you earn a profit.
- **Example 2**: You believe that the EUR/USD currency pair will fall in the next 10 minutes. You choose "Down" from the dropdown menu and invest $20. If the price drops as predicted, you receive a payout.
Risk Management Tips
While dropdown options are simple, it's essential to manage your risks effectively. Here are some tips:
- **Start Small**: Begin with small investments to minimize potential losses while you learn the ropes.
- **Use a Demo Account**: Practice with a demo account to gain experience without risking real money.
- **Set a Budget**: Determine how much you are willing to lose and stick to it. Never invest more than you can afford to lose.
- **Diversify Your Trades**: Avoid putting all your money into a single trade. Spread your investments across different assets to reduce risk.
